Branch-and-price approaches for the Multiperiod Technician Routing and Scheduling Problem

This paper addresses a technician routing and scheduling problem motivated by the case of an external maintenance provider. Technicians are proficient in different skills and paired into teams to perform maintenance tasks. Tasks are skill constrained and have time windows that may span multiple days. The objective is to determine the daily assignment of technicians into teams, of teams to tasks, and of teams to daily routes such that the operation costs are minimized. We propose a mixed integer program and a branch-and-price algorithm to solve this problem. Exploiting the structure of the problem, alternative formulations are used for the column generation-phase of the algorithm. Using real-world data from an external maintenance provider, we conduct numerical studies to evaluate the performance of our proposed solution approaches. (C) 2016 Elsevier B.V. All rights reserved.
